Well today I made some progress with texfont.pl. After getting my Lucida
fonts to work I decided to tackle:

http://www.pragma-ade.com:8080/context/Members/willi/My%20Way/NaturalTables.
tex

Got my Palatino fonts installed and working, even the slanted ones! :-)

Found that I need pixfonts, which I updated using the Miktex package
manager. Then I set texfont to work on these pixfonts. I am just about
there, but hung up on the last little bit.

In trying to compile NaturalTables.tex with:

texexec --pdf --mode=MyWay NaturalTables.tex

I get this warning at the end of my log file.

Warning: PDFETEX (file rpxmi): Font rpxmi at 600 not found

Warning: PDFETEX (file pxsy): Font pxsy at 600 not found
{8r.enc}<uplr8a.pfb><uplb8a.pfb>
<f:\localtexmf\fonts\pk\ljfour\jknappen\ec\dpi
645\ectt1000.pk><uplr8a.pfb>
Output written on NaturalTables.pdf (10 pages, 138726 bytes).

Opening the PDF file leads to problems. The first page loads OK, but paging
down I get:

1. There was an error processing a page. There was a problem reading this
document(14).
2. Could not find a font in the Resources directory--using Helvetica instead.
3. There was a problem reading the document.

Examining the fonts in the pdf file shows:

URWPalladioL-Roma
F104
URWPalladioL-Bold
Helvetica

So, some sort of font substitution seems to have occurred.

Any help or suggestions coming my would be appreciated.
